Die vorliegende Übersetzung wurde maschinell erstellt. Im Falle eines Konflikts oder eines Widerspruchs zwischen dieser übersetzten Fassung und der englischen Fassung (einschließlich infolge von Verzögerungen bei der Übersetzung) ist die englische Fassung maßgeblich.
Was ist Amazon OpenSearch Service?
Amazon OpenSearch Service ist ein verwalteter Service, der die Bereitstellung, den Betrieb und die Skalierung von OpenSearch Clustern in der AWS Cloud vereinfacht. Eine OpenSearch Service-Domain ist gleichbedeutend mit einem OpenSearch Cluster. Domains sind Cluster mit den Einstellungen, Instance-Typen, Instance-Anzahl und Speicherressourcen, die Sie angeben. Amazon OpenSearch Service unterstützt OpenSearch ältere Versionen von Elasticsearch OSS (bis zu 7.10, der endgültigen Open-Source-Version der Software). Wenn Sie eine Domain erstellen, haben Sie die Wahl, welche Suchmaschine Sie verwenden möchten.
OpenSearchist eine vollständig quelloffene Such- und Analysemaschine für Anwendungsfälle wie Protokollanalysen, Anwendungsüberwachung in Echtzeit und Clickstream-Analyse. Weitere Informationen finden Sie in der OpenSearch -Dokumentation
Amazon OpenSearch Service stellt alle Ressourcen für Ihren OpenSearch Cluster bereit und startet ihn. Außerdem werden ausgefallene OpenSearch Serviceknoten automatisch erkannt und ersetzt, wodurch der mit selbstverwalteten Infrastrukturen verbundene Aufwand reduziert wird. Sie können Ihren Cluster mit einem einzigen API Aufruf oder mit ein paar Klicks in der Konsole skalieren.
![Diagram showing data flow from input sources through Amazon OpenSearch Service to output applications.](images/whatis.png)
Um mit der Nutzung von OpenSearch Service zu beginnen, erstellen Sie eine OpenSearch Service-Domain, die einem OpenSearch Cluster entspricht. Jede EC2 Instanz im Cluster fungiert als ein OpenSearch Dienstknoten.
Sie können die OpenSearch Servicekonsole verwenden, um eine Domain innerhalb von Minuten einzurichten und zu konfigurieren. Wenn Sie den programmatischen Zugriff bevorzugen, können Sie den AWS CLIAWS SDKs
Funktionen von Amazon OpenSearch Service
OpenSearch Der Service umfasst die folgenden Funktionen:
Skalieren
-
Zahlreiche Konfigurationen von CPU Arbeitsspeicher und Speicherkapazität, die als Instance-Typen bezeichnet werden, einschließlich kostengünstiger Graviton-Instances
-
Unterstützt bis zu 1002 Datenknoten
-
Bis zu 25 PB angeschlossener Speicher
-
UltraWarmKostengünstiger Kaltspeicher für schreibgeschützte Daten
Sicherheit
-
AWS Identity and Access Management (IAM) Zugriffskontrolle
-
Einfache Integration mit Amazon VPC und VPC Sicherheitsgruppen
-
Verschlüsselung ruhender Daten und node-to-node Verschlüsselung
-
Amazon Cognito, HTTP Basic oder SAML Authentifizierung für Dashboards OpenSearch
-
Sicherheit auf Index-Ebene, Dokumentebene und Feldebene
-
Prüfungsprotokolle
-
Dashboards-Multi-Tenancy
Stabilität
-
Mehrere geografische Standorte für Ihre Ressourcen, bezeichnet als Regionen und Availability Zones
-
Knotenzuweisung über zwei oder drei Availability Zones in derselben AWS Region, bekannt als Multi-AZ
-
Dedizierte Hauptknoten für die Auslagerung von Cluster-Management-Aufgaben
-
Automatisierte Snapshots zur Sicherung und Wiederherstellung OpenSearch von Service-Domains
Flexibilität
-
SQLUnterstützung für die Integration mit Business Intelligence (BI) -Anwendungen
-
Benutzerdefinierte Pakete zur Verbesserung der Suchergebnisse
Integration in beliebte Services
-
Datenvisualisierung mithilfe von OpenSearch Dashboards
-
Integration mit Amazon CloudWatch zur Überwachung von OpenSearch Service-Domain-Metriken und zur Einstellung von Alarmen
-
Integration mit AWS CloudTrail zur Prüfung von API Konfigurationsaufrufen für OpenSearch Service-Domains
-
Integration mit Amazon S3, Amazon Kinesis und Amazon DynamoDB zum Laden von Streaming-Daten in Service OpenSearch
-
Benachrichtigungen von AmazonSNS, wenn Ihre Daten bestimmte Schwellenwerte überschreiten
Wann sollte ich den Service OpenSearch im Vergleich zu Amazon OpenSearch Service verwenden
Anhand der folgenden Tabelle können Sie entscheiden, ob der bereitgestellte Amazon OpenSearch Service oder der selbstverwaltete Service die richtige Wahl für Sie OpenSearch ist.
OpenSearch | OpenSearch Amazon-Dienst |
---|---|
|
|
Unterstützte Versionen von und OpenSearch Elasticsearch
OpenSearch Der Service unterstützt mehrere Versionen von OpenSearch und ältere Open-Source-Versionen von Elasticsearch. Für einige Versionen haben wir bereits das Ende des Standardsupports und das Datum der Verlängerung des Supports veröffentlicht. Es wird empfohlen, auf die neueste verfügbare OpenSearch Version zu aktualisieren, um den OpenSearch Service in Bezug auf Preis-Leistungs-Verhältnis, Funktionsvielfalt und Sicherheitsverbesserungen optimal nutzen zu können. In der folgenden Tabelle finden Sie eine Liste der Versionen und deren Support-Zeitplan:
Das Ende des Supportzeitplans für Elasticsearch-Versionen sieht wie folgt aus:
Softwareversion | Ende des Standard-Supports | Ende des erweiterten Support |
---|---|---|
Elasticsearch-Versionen 1.5 und 2.3 | 7. November 2025 | 7. November 2026 |
Elasticsearch-Versionen 5.1 bis 5.5 | 7. November 2025 | 7. November 2026 |
Elasticsearch-Versionen 5.6 | 7. November 2025 | 7. November 2028 |
Elasticsearch-Versionen 6.0 bis 6.7 | 7. November 2025 | 7. November 2026 |
Elasticsearch-Versionen 6.8 | Nicht angekündigt | Nicht angekündigt |
Elasticsearch-Versionen 7.1 bis 7.8 | 7. November 2025 | 7. November 2026 |
Elasticsearch-Versionen 7.9 | Nicht angekündigt | Nicht angekündigt |
Elasticsearch-Versionen 7.10 | Nicht angekündigt | Nicht angekündigt |
Der Zeitplan für das Ende des Supports für OpenSearch Versionen sieht wie folgt aus:
Version der Software | Ende des Standard-Supports | Ende des erweiterten Support |
---|---|---|
OpenSearch Versionen 1.0 und 1.2 | 7. November 2025 | 7. November 2026 |
OpenSearch Versionen 1.3 | Nicht angekündigt | Nicht angekündigt |
OpenSearch Versionen 2.3 bis 2.9 | 7. November 2025 | 7. November 2026 |
OpenSearch Versionen 2.11 und höhere Versionen | Nicht angekündigt | Nicht angekündigt |
Standardsupport und erweiterter Support für Elasticsearch OpenSearch
AWS bietet regelmäßige Bugfixes und Sicherheitsupdates für Versionen, die unter den Standard-Support fallen. AWS Stellt für Versionen mit erweitertem Support kritische Sicherheitsupdates für einen Zeitraum von mindestens 12 Monaten nach Ende des Standard-Supports gegen eine zusätzliche Pauschalgebühr für jede Normalized Instance Hour (NIH) bereit. NIHwird als Faktor der Instance-Größe (z. B. mittel, groß) und der Anzahl der Instance-Stunden berechnet (ein Beispiel finden Sie im Abschnitt „Berechnung der Gebühren für erweiterten Support“ weiter unten). Gebühren für erweiterten Support werden automatisch berechnet, wenn auf einer Domain eine Version ausgeführt wird, für die der Standardsupport abgelaufen ist. Sie können ein Upgrade auf eine aktuelle Version durchführen, für die weiterhin der Standardsupport gilt, um Gebühren für erweiterten Support zu vermeiden. Weitere Informationen zu den Gebühren für erweiterten Support finden Sie unter Kosten für erweiterten Support
Berechnung der Gebühren für erweiterten Support
Für Domains, für die Versionen mit erweitertem Support ausgeführt werden, wird ein pauschaler Aufpreis berechnetfee/Normalized Instance Hour (NIH), for example, $0.0065 in the US East (North Virginia) Region. NIH is computed as a factor of the instance size (e.g., medium, large), and the number of instance hours. For example, if you are running an m7g.medium.search instance for 24 hours in the US East (North Virginia) Region, which is priced at $0.068/Instance hour (on-demand), you will typically pay $1.632 ($0.068x24). If you are running a version that is in extended support, you will pay an additional $0.0065/NIH, der als 0,0065$ x 24 (Anzahl der Instanzstunden) x 2 (Größennormalisierungsfaktor; 2 für mittelgroße Instances) berechnet wird, was 0,312$ für erweiterten Support für 24 Stunden entspricht. Der Gesamtbetrag, den Sie für 24 Stunden zahlen, setzt sich aus den Kosten für die Nutzung der Standard-Instance und den Kosten für den erweiterten Support zusammen, die sich auf 1,944 USD (1,632 USD+0,312 USD) belaufen. Die folgende Tabelle zeigt den Normalisierungsfaktor für verschiedene Instance-Größen in Service. OpenSearch
Instance-Größe | Normalisierungsfaktor |
---|---|
Nano | 0,25 |
Micro | 0,5 |
small | 1 |
Medium | 2 |
large | 4 |
xlarge | 8 |
2xlarge | 16 |
4xlarge | 32 |
8xlarge | 64 |
9xlarge | 72 |
10xlarge | 80 |
12xlarge | 96 |
16xlarge | 128 |
18xlarge | 144 |
24xlarge | 192 |
32xlarge | 256 |
Preise für Amazon OpenSearch Service
Bei OpenSearch Service zahlen Sie für jede Nutzungsstunde einer EC2 Instance und für die Gesamtgröße aller an Ihre Instances angehängten EBS Speichervolumes. Es fallen auch AWS die üblichen Datenübertragungsgebühren
Es gibt jedoch einige wichtige Datenübertragungsausnahmen. Wenn eine Domain mehrere Availability Zones verwendet, stellt der OpenSearch Service den Datenverkehr zwischen den Availability Zones nicht in Rechnung. Während der Shard-Zuweisung und des Rebalancing findet innerhalb einer Domain ein erheblicher Datentransfer statt. OpenSearch Warten Sie für diesen Verkehr weder Zähler noch Rechnungen. Ebenso berechnet der OpenSearch Service keine Datenübertragungen zwischen UltraWarm/cold nodes und Amazon S3.
Vollständige Preisinformationen finden Sie unter Amazon OpenSearch Service-Preise
Zugehörige Services
OpenSearch Der Service wird üblicherweise mit den folgenden Diensten genutzt:
- Amazon CloudWatch
-
OpenSearch Dienstdomänen senden automatisch Messwerte an, CloudWatch sodass Sie den Zustand und die Leistung der Domain überwachen können. Weitere Informationen finden Sie unter Überwachung von OpenSearch Cluster-Metriken mit Amazon CloudWatch.
CloudWatch Protokolle können auch in die andere Richtung gehen. Sie können CloudWatch Logs so konfigurieren, dass Daten zur Analyse an den OpenSearch Service gestreamt werden. Weitere Informationen hierzu finden Sie unter Streaming-Daten von Amazon laden CloudWatch.
- AWS CloudTrail
-
AWS CloudTrail Dient zum Abrufen eines Verlaufs der API Aufrufe der OpenSearch Dienstkonfiguration und verwandter Ereignisse für Ihr Konto. Weitere Informationen finden Sie unter Überwachen von OpenSearch Amazon--Service-API-Aufrufen mit AWS CloudTrail.
- Amazon Kinesis
-
Kinesis ist ein vollständig verwalteter Service für die Verarbeitung riesiger Streaming-Datenmengen in Echtzeit. Weitere Informationen erhalten Sie unter So laden Sie Streaming-Daten aus Amazon Kinesis Data Streams und Streaming-Daten von Amazon Data Firehose laden.
- Amazon S3
-
Amazon Simple Storage Service (Amazon S3) bietet Speicher für das Internet. Dieser Leitfaden bietet Lambda-Beispiel-Code für die Integration mit Amazon S3. Weitere Informationen finden Sie unter So laden Sie Streaming-Daten aus Amazon S3.
- AWS IAM
-
AWS Identity and Access Management (IAM) ist ein Webdienst, mit dem Sie den Zugriff auf Ihre OpenSearch Service-Domains verwalten können. Weitere Informationen finden Sie unter Identity and Access Management in Amazon OpenSearch Service.
- AWS Lambda
-
AWS Lambda ist ein Rechendienst, mit dem Sie Code ausführen können, ohne Server bereitzustellen oder zu verwalten. Dieser Leitfaden bietet Lambda-Beispiel-Code für das Streamen von Daten aus DynamoDB, Amazon S3 und Kinesis. Weitere Informationen finden Sie unter Streaming-Daten in Amazon OpenSearch Service laden.
- Amazon-DynamoDB
-
Amazon DynamoDB ist ein vollständig verwalteter Service ohne SQL Datenbank, der schnelle und vorhersehbare Leistung mit nahtloser Skalierbarkeit bietet. Weitere Informationen zum Streamen von Daten an den OpenSearch Service finden Sie unter. So laden Sie Streaming-Daten aus Amazon DynamoDB
- Amazon QuickSight
-
Sie können Daten aus OpenSearch Service mithilfe von QuickSight Amazon-Dashboards visualisieren. Weitere Informationen finden Sie unter Verwenden von Amazon OpenSearch Service mit Amazon QuickSight im QuickSight Amazon-Benutzerhandbuch.
Anmerkung
OpenSearch beinhaltet bestimmten Apache-lizenzierten Elasticsearch-Code von Elasticsearch B.V. und anderen Quellcode. Elasticsearch B.V. ist nicht die Quelle dieses anderen Quellcodes. ELASTICSEARCHist eine eingetragene Marke von Elasticsearch B.V.